AIRPORT WORKERS – Two(2) persons working in a restaurant inside the Ninoy Aquino International Airport (NAIA) Terminal 3 will face charges for not returning a wallet found with Php 100,000.00.

Workers in Ninoy Aquino International Airport (NAIA) are mandated to return the lost things they will find inside the vicinity. Even if there are no contact details on the item, they must turn it over to the lost and found section.

The gesture of honesty is an order of the Manila International Airport Authority (MIAA). Somehow, it provides assurance for passengers who sometimes leave their things unintentionally in the pursuit of catching a flight or after a tiring travel for hours.

However, recently, there were some workers in NAIA 3 that violated the order of the MIAA.

Based on a recent report on ABS-CBN News, two(2) airport workers in NAIA 3 did not return the lost wallet they found with Php 100,000.00. They are set to face charges because of it.

According to NAIA Terminal 3 airport police head Capt. Goldwin Cuarteros, the workers who are working in a restaurant inside NAIA Terminal 3 found the wallet in a parking lot. They were on their way home when they found the item with a huge amount of cash.

Someone saw it and reported to the airport authorities regarding the matter. Based on the report, the two(2) workers were then put on hold and an investigation was done.

Both workers admitted that they found a wallet with some Php 100,000.00 cash. According to them, they were afraid so they did not return the item. They will be facing charges and were also asked to give up their access identification passes to NAIA.

MIAA general manager Ed Monreal has ordered Capt. Cuarteros to identify the owner of the wallet found. He asked the latter to review the CCTV.
